(from the graph) the best yield is obtained at high pressure;
and low temperature;
it is a reversible reaction;
in which formation of ammonia is favoured at low temperature
(because) the reaction is exothermic;
and the formation of ammonia is favoured at high pressure
because greater number of gaseous reactant molecules than
gaseous product molecules/because greater vol of reactant
than volume of product molecules;
pressure used is limited by cost/materials;
rate of reaction slow at low temperatures;
actual temperature and pressure used is a good compromise
(between a good yield and reasonable rate);
removal of ammonia makes rate more important than yield;
